The only way that happens is the AI is switching positions at the time the substitution is made. Example..

CF bats 8th, SS bats 4th
A player comes into the game and is put in the 4th spot. At the same time he is set to play CF. The current 8 hitter plays both CF and SS and at that time is moved to SS.

Or it's a double switch and a new player comes into the 8 spot and is placed at SS, along with a new player coming into the 4 spot and being placed in CF.
